Team — quick summary for the weekly sync. We cut the Harrowgate Arena turnstile counter over from the legacy GateTally service to CountMarsh on Tuesday night. All 42 gates reported cleanly within ten minutes, and reconciliation against manual tallies from the Thursday match showed under 0.3% variance. Rollback window closed Friday; legacy ingestion is now disabled. One open item: gate 17 occasionally double-fires, which we are tracking separately. The production configuration CountMarsh is now running with is shown below.

settings of yahaf-tahop:
jorox:
  pin: 5851
  tenant: noveth
  seal: seal_7ddb5c42
  metrics_host: metrics.jorox.ordinnet.example
  standby_team: wenax
  escalation: oliath-feneth
  nonce: 552548

## Env vars: EXIF scrubber

Quick notes for the eng sync: Pixelrinse strips EXIF on upload, and most knobs moved to the config service last sprint. The only things left in the env file are the scrub-level flag (keep it at `strict` unless legal says otherwise) and the queue credential. The flag is documented on the ops page; the credential line comes right after this sentence.

secret setting of yajog-taguf: ARCHIVE_KEY3=051

## Flaglight Rollout Framework

Flaglight gates all staged rollouts at Pinecrest Systems. Flags evaluate server-side only; no targeting rules ship to clients. Audit log captures every flag mutation with actor and diff. Kill switch reverts a flag fleet-wide in under ten seconds. Review focus areas: evaluation cache TTL (30s), rule-engine sandboxing, and the admin API surface. Access requires the service credential scoped to read-only review. Request elevation through Gatekeep if write access is needed. The reviewer key follows below.

API key for yahig-tadup: kto7_ubizbYm